Alex Iwobi Surpasses Mikel in Premier League Stats

Super Eagles Midfielder Alex Iwobi, has reached a significant milestone in his Premier League career.

During Fulham’s match against Crystal Palace, Iwobi marked his 250th appearance in the league surpassing former Chelsea midfielder John Obi Mikel.

 

Iwobi now stands as the fourth-highest capped Nigerian player in the history of the Premier League.

Shola Ameobi leads the chart with an impressive 298 games, followed closely by Nwankwo Kanu who made appearances for Arsenal, West Brom and Portsmouth.

Yakubu Aiyegbeni holds the third position with 252 games, while Mikel now occupies the fifth spot with 249 appearances.

Joseph Yobo completes the top six with 228 matches under his belt.

Alex Iwobi previously played for Arsenal, and Everton before joining Fulham.
